Abstract

This paper proposes a new high-precision feedforward tracking control system in single-rate sampling. The experimental results confirm that the proposed system well suppresses the tracking error on condition of disk rotation speed 7200[rpm] DVD. Therefore, the proposed system realizes high-precision tracking control.
